Across the Ipswich Police district we are observing Seniors Week August 18-26 to celebrate seniors for their generosity of spirit and contribution to community.
Ipswich District Crime Prevention attended the Seniors Week Expo held at Rosewood and Ipswich to acknowledge seniors in the community.
Over 100 seniors gathered for a free luncheon provided by the Rosewood and District Support Centre at the Rosewood Cultural Centre where service providers, NGOs and Queensland Government representatives held static displays focusing on a variety of health and well-being support services to assist seniors in their everyday life.
Queensland Police Service provided a stall aimed at personal, property and home security and internet safety, delivering a presentation on Computer Security for seniors.
Further events held for seniors were at the Ipswich City Council Humanities Building, where seniors were also acknowledged and given useful information on service providers in their local area.
